A cryptographic weakness exists in the Omada adoption protocol where session encryption keys used to protect communications between controllers and managed devices may be predictable due to insufficient entropy in session key generation.
An attacker who successfully intercepts adoption-related communications may be able to recover session encryption keys and decrypt affected communications.
